Definitions
- the invention relates to a frame element according to the preamble of the main claim.
- Picture frames for receiving double glass panes are known in which the glass panes engage in grooves on the picture frame.
- a particularly representative appearance can be achieved when double glass panes are used as image carriers by positioning the double glass panes at a certain distance from the wall. For this, however, no solutions are known in which screw connections or the like unsightly fastening elements would not be visible.
- the invention has for its object to provide a frame element with the art objects or the like Chen are presentable, with no mounting screws or the like should be visible.
- a retaining strip running around the top of the base clamps the image carrier, which is preferably designed as a double glass pane, firmly onto the top of the base.
- the retaining strip has a specific profile, which snaps into place on locking elements which are concealed in the base.
- the latching elements are preferably designed as resilient metal brackets or plastic elements which have latching lugs which each engage the profile of the retaining strip. When attaching the retaining strip, this engages with the latching elements and thereby holds the image carrier or another object on the surface of the base in a defined position, without the need for special tools during assembly.
- the locking elements can be arranged at regular intervals in order to ensure a uniform connection between the base and the holding strip. Furthermore, the circumferential retaining strip can be mitred at the frame corners, the retaining strip being cut to the desired length as an elongated, thin-walled metal or plastic profile.
- the base can be made of solid wood, metal or plastic profile and have cavities at certain intervals in which the locking elements are arranged.
- the retaining strip is formed as part of the frame, a particularly simple locking element being used, which consists only of a flat, long stretched fastening section with fastening holes, on which a latching tab protrudes vertically in the middle.
- a support bearing is arranged, which engages the frame or on the back of a support element.
- This latching element has along its base, which forms the fastening section, a sufficient elasticity in the form of a plastic part, which enables a spring-elastic tensioning of the support elements.
- a particularly advantageous development of the invention uses a frame element which is constructed from an upper holding part and a base part as a double frame.
- the base frame is made of metal or plastic and either sits directly on the rear support element, which can be a glass pane or chipboard, or lies on an intermediate piece shaped as a U-profile, so that, for example, different thicknesses of passpartout can be accommodated between the support elements. Since the locking elements allow different pass making thicknesses due to their elasticity, a wide range of different pass making thicknesses can be accommodated in the frame element in connection with a spacer element designed as an asymmetrical U-profile.
- Large spacing elements can be arranged between the holding part and the base part, which define the distance between two glass plates or similar supporting elements arranged one above the other. This creates a space between the support elements in which larger objects, e.g. Clockworks, electrical circuits, works of art, can be used.
- a frame element designed in this way can also be designed as a type case.
- a mirrored wall can be provided on the back, which is fastened to the locking elements of the frame element by simple screwing or by clamping.
- double-walled support elements can be used, between which coins are positioned, for example. In this way it is possible to present coins so that one side of the coins is visible from the front, while the other side of the coin appears in the mirrored rear wall.
- a central lock can be provided on the frame element, which longitudinally displaces sliders running in the base of the frame element, elongated holes or other cutouts provided on the sliders in the area of the fastening screws in a closed position or in a Opening position can be brought.
- the slider can be narrow metal or plastic strips, which are longitudinally displaceable in a manner known per se by the actuating lever of a lock. In the corners of the frame, the longitudinal movement can be redirected from a slide to the adjacent slide, which is offset by 90 °, so that all fastening screws distributed over the entire frame can be secured by means of a single lock.
- the locking function can also ensure that the frame is firmly connected to the wall, with the possibility that when opening and lifting the frame, the rear wall with the shelves attached to it remains on the wall.
- This has the advantage, particularly for showcases, of realizing both functions of the cover in accordance with a door function and the wall fastening in accordance with the customary screwing of the rear wall or a reinforcement on it with the wall in a single mechanism.
- the frame element can easily be provided with low-voltage lighting, a metal frame part or the metal retaining strip forming one of the two required current conductors. This makes the power supply to the lighting device particularly simple.
- the frame element can furthermore be provided with a frame channel that extends in the longitudinal direction and can be covered, in which electrical components or other components can be used in a concealed manner.
- the frame element thus forms an elongated or circumferential housing for accommodating different devices.
- the frame element can also be used as a load-bearing element for furniture parts, inserts such as a small shelf, hooks, stops or the like being attachable to the latching elements.
- the frame element can thus in particular form the door frame of kitchen furniture or office furniture.
- a peripheral frame element or a double frame forms the outer frame of a display case.
- the double frame can be kept at a distance by means of spacers, which means that a variable depth can be achieved for showcases.
- the frame element can consist of an inner and an outer circumferential frame, an oil painting in particular being able to be held in the inner frame.
- the stretcher is received by a metal or plastic holding frame and pressed onto a glass or chipboard, while a rear connecting plate runs at a distance from the oil painting and connects the inner frame to the outer frame.
- the frame element shown in FIG. 1 consists of an approximately trapezoidal base 1 and a retaining strip 2, which fixes two glass panes 3, 4 arranged one above the other on the upper side of the base 1.
- An image 5 is inserted between the glass panes 3, 4, as a result of which the image 5 is positioned at a clear distance from the wall.
- FIG. 2 shows a cross section in the area of the locking element 6, the function of which is explained in more detail below with reference to the two FIGS. 1 and 2.
- the latching element 6 has a fastening web 7 with fastening holes 8, from which a latching tab 9 projects vertically in the middle, which latches with a latching lug 10 on the profile of the retaining strip 2.
- a fastening web 7 with fastening holes 8, from which a latching tab 9 projects vertically in the middle, which latches with a latching lug 10 on the profile of the retaining strip 2.
- webs projecting vertically in the form of two support bearings 11 are formed, which are clearly visible in particular in FIG. 3.
- the locking element is supported with the support bearings 11 on the base 1 and thus braces the retaining bar 2 with the base 1 via the locking tab 6.
- the locking element Since the locking element has a certain elasticity in the area of the locking lug 10 and also in the area of its fastening surface 7, the retaining bar becomes with its projection 12 from above on the Glass pane 3 pressed, whereby both glass sheets 3, 4 are firmly clamped to the frame element.
- FIG. 4 shows another exemplary embodiment of a latching element 13, which forms a metallic spring element.
- the locking element 6, however, is preferably made of plastic.
- Figure 5 shows the locking element 13 cut in the middle in a perspective view. Also on this locking element 13, a locking lug 10 is formed, which engages the profile of a retaining bar 2a and thus also clamps the glass panes 3, 4 on the base 1.
- the locking elements 6, 13 are inserted in recesses 14, 15 on the base 1.
- a bent support bracket 16 acts as a support element with which the locking element 13 is supported on the base 1.
- a locking element 17 is used, which is shown in Figure 7 in a perspective view.
- the support bearings 18 are the support surfaces for the objects to be fastened.
- a plate 19 lies on the support bearings 18 and is covered by a glass plate 20.
- the base 21 is guided upwards so far that it simultaneously takes over the function of the holding strip as an integral part and engages over the glass plate 20 with a projection 22.
- the locking element 17 can be slightly modified in the area of the support bearings 18.
- a protruding pin 23 can protrude upward on each support bearing, which engages in a corresponding groove 24 on the underside of the plate 19.
- the frame part is essentially made of a two-part base 1a, 1b, the holding part 1b being clamped to the base part 1a via the latching element 6.
- a U-shaped spacer element 25 is inserted between the base part 1a and the back of the glass plate 4, which, depending on the position, defines two distances between the glass plate 4 and the base part 1a. If the inserted spacer element 25 is completely omitted, the result is the embodiment according to FIG. 12, which can accommodate a particularly strong mat 26 between the glass plates 3, 4.
- the glass plates 3, 4 carry the image and passes-partout 26 stored between them, which is why the glass plates 3, 4 can also be referred to as supporting elements.
- glass plates or support elements 27, 28 are kept at a distance by means of a spacer element 29 arranged between the support elements 27, 28. This creates a space in which art objects or other objective objects 30 can be introduced.
- coins are stored between two glass plates 3, 4 in openings of a transparent intermediate plate, of which one coin 33 is shown in the drawing.
- a mirrored plate 34 runs in the area of the rear of the frame element, so that the viewer can view one side of the coin 33 from above and the other side of the coin 33 in the rear-view mirror 35.
- the mirrored plate 33 is clamped with fastening element 36 on the back of the base 1 and on the latching element 6.
- FIG. 15 Another application of the frame element according to the invention is that according to FIG. 15 there is an intermediate disk 37 is provided, on which an object 38 to be presented is positioned.
- an optically “floating” arrangement for the object 38 is obtained, which here represents a faceted mirror, for example.
- FIG. 16 and 17 show the side view and the top view of the mechanism of a frame lock.
- the frame lock (not shown here), which is known per se, operates one of the slides 39, 40 shown in the longitudinal direction with a bolt when the locking cylinder rotates, the longitudinal displacement, for example of the slider 39, in the arrow direction 41 being transmitted to the slider 40 via a control disk 42.
- the control disk 42 has pins 43, 44 which engage in elongated holes 45, 46 on the sliders 39, 40.
- the slide 40 In the position shown, the slide 40 is in the locked position, i.e. the fastening screw 47 cannot be passed with its screw head through the widened opening 48 of the locking element 6 by lifting the frame element. Only when the elongated hole 49 is moved from the position shown to a lower position by actuating the slide 40 in the direction of arrow 41a can the frame element be removed from the fastening screw 47.
- FIGS. 18 to 20 show the attachment of low-voltage lighting to the frame element.
- a halogen lamp 50 is supplied with the required operating voltage using metallic frame parts.
- the electrical connecting lines 51, 52 are preferably connected to a voltage source with an operating voltage of 12 volts, which is why the retaining strip 2 can be used as an electrical conductor.
- the Holding bar 2 can still be touched by people without risk.
- the socket holder 50a which carries the socket 50b, forms an electrical feed line and is fastened to the holding strip by simply plugging it in and is clamped between the holding strip and the base.
- the frame element has a frame channel 55 in which electrical components 56 are inserted.
- the electrical components 56 can be used, for example, to supply power to the low-voltage lighting.
- FIG. 23 shows the frame element as a door frame 58 for a door 59 of a piece of furniture, a frame 60 being fastened to the latching elements 6 of the frame element 58 on the back of the door 59.
- the furniture part shown in FIG. 23 is shown in closed form in FIG. 24, the door surface 61 being formed by one or more plates clamped on the frame element 58.
- FIG. 25 and FIG. 26 show further possible uses of the frame element in furniture.
- FIG. 27 shows the upper frame part of a display case, which is formed by two frame elements 62, 63 screwed together on their base surfaces.
- the screw connection 64 takes place through the fastening holes of the latching elements 6.
- a display case constructed in this way can be set up in various ways in connection with a floor stand 66 according to FIG. 28 or in accordance with the embodiments shown in FIGS. 29, 31 and 32.
- FIG. 29 is a showcase 67 suspended from a ceiling, while the showcase according to FIG. 31 is attached to a wall or a tubular frame.
- the display case 67 is designed as a table tripod.
- FIGS. 30 and 33 show two versions of suspension devices which are connected to the locking element via the fastening screws 68.
- FIG. 30 there is a tab 69, while in FIG. 33 an angle 70 with an integrally formed lateral fastening element 71 is provided.
- the fastening element 71 can be a hinge element.
- a widened version of a display case 72 is obtained by using an intermediate piece 73, which connects frame elements 62, 63 at its ends, as shown in FIG. 34.
- a frame element 62 is screwed onto a wall 75 via a fastening piece 74.
- FIG. 38 show further embodiments.
- FIG. 39 shows in cross section a frame element which consists of an inner frame 76 and an outer frame 77.
- a retaining bar 2 is pressed from above against an oil painting 78 by means of a latching element 6, the back of which rests on a stretcher frame 79.
- a connecting plate 80 connecting the two frames 76, 77 runs on the rear side and is connected to the outer frame 77 with its edge tense.
- a locking element 6 is also used in connection with a retaining bar 2.
- a spacer element 81 is located between the holding strip 2 and the edge of the connecting plate 80 in order to transmit the clamping force.
- FIG. 40 shows the top view of the arrangement according to FIG. 39.
